Bakers Choice Products, Inc., a leading name in the baking industry, is headquartered in the United States and serves major operational regions across North America. Founded in the early 2000s, the company has established itself as a trusted provider of high-quality baking ingredients and supplies, catering to both professional bakers and home enthusiasts.
Specialising in a diverse range of products, Bakers Choice offers unique blends of flours, mixes, and specialty ingredients that stand out for their quality and consistency. The company’s commitment to innovation and customer satisfaction has solidified its market position, making it a preferred choice among baking professionals. With a focus on sustainability and excellence, Bakers Choice Products, Inc. continues to achieve notable milestones in the baking sector, reinforcing its reputation as a cornerstone of the industry.

Bakers Choice Products, Inc., headquartered in the US, currently does not report specific carbon emissions data for the most recent year, as no emissions figures are available. The company is a current subsidiary of Alcoa Corporation, which influences its climate commitments and emissions reporting.
While Bakers Choice Products, Inc. has not established its own reduction targets or specific climate pledges, it inherits relevant data and initiatives from Alcoa Corporation. This includes participation in the Carbon Disclosure Project (CDP) at a cascade level of 2, which indicates that emissions data and climate strategies are aligned with those of its parent company.
As part of the broader industry context, it is essential for companies like Bakers Choice to engage in climate action and set reduction targets to mitigate their environmental impact. However, without specific emissions data or reduction initiatives outlined for Bakers Choice, the focus remains on the overarching commitments and strategies of Alcoa Corporation.
